Sensational Sensationalism

Men’s Pulp Mags blogger Robert Deis (aka Subtropic Bob) looks back at the work of Norman Baer, “one of many highly talented illustration artists who worked for men’s adventure magazines during part of their careers.” Especially worth checking out in Deis’ post is the artwork Baer did for Cavalier magazine, which once ran short stories by Mickey Spillane and Richard S. Prather.
